CPU comparisonIntel Core i5-3320M or AMD 3020e - which processor is faster? In this comparison we look at the differences and analyze which of these two CPUs is better. We compare the technical data and benchmark results.
The Intel Core i5-3320M has 2 cores with 4 threads and clocks with a maximum frequency of 3.30 GHz. Up to 32 GB of memory is supported in 2 memory channels. The Intel Core i5-3320M was released in Q2/2012. The AMD 3020e has 2 cores with 4 threads and clocks with a maximum frequency of 2.60 GHz. The CPU supports up to 32 GB of memory in 2 memory channels. The AMD 3020e was released in Q1/2020. |

Memory & PCIeThe Intel Core i5-3320M can use up to 32 GB of memory in 2 memory channels. The maximum memory bandwidth is 25.6 GB/s. The AMD 3020e supports up to 32 GB of memory in 2 memory channels and achieves a memory bandwidth of up to 38.4 GB/s. |

Thermal ManagementThe thermal design power (TDP for short) of the Intel Core i5-3320M is 35 W, while the AMD 3020e has a TDP of 6 W. The TDP specifies the necessary cooling solution that is required to cool the processor sufficiently. |
